Identity as a Service with Vittorio Bertocci

How can you keep your customer identity information safe? While at Techorama in Mechelen, Belgium, Carl and Richard talk to Vittorio Bertocci about Microsoft's offerings around Azure Active Directory. With all the data breaches going on these days, its wise to consider offloading the work of managing your customer's personally identifiable information to a service that has as much security around it as possible. Vittorio talks about the new B2C service on Azure offering the ability to store custom information, authorization tokens - everything you'll need to know who your user is and what they are able to do. That's half your security battle done, just gotta secure your transactions!
